Etymology edit

Literally, on [a] notebook, from the fact that when someone wants to buy something on credit, their name is jotted down in a notebook and is crossed out when the money is paid off.

Adverb edit

na zeszyt (not comparable)

  1. (colloquial, idiomatic) on credit, on margin, on tick (bought with an agreement to pay later)
    Synonyms: na krechę, na kreskę, na kredyt
